Transaction 9986ece4d6e7c44d49b72a1c75e88b64858fae4f11a50c7c55a93bb056ce61e0

block
28bced0cc76515f85d5df0eb0a42da31acea900ad98f3757fada3b5c9ab6d042

1 Input

23 Outputs